    Budget and Compensation
- Jane Focht-Hansen, English - Chair
- Alex Bernal, English
- Isabel Garcia, Physics, Engineering, & Architecture
- Jim Lucchelli, Counseling & Student Development
- Ellen Marshall, Early Childhood Studies
- Christina Olson, Nursing Education
- Cheryl Startzell, Allied Health
- Committee Charge: To review and analyze the historic trends of faculty salary increases; and propose (and justify) an adequate raise for the 2009-10 academic year. The committee will evaluate the current salary schedule and recommend improvements if warranted. In addition to reviewing Texas community college salaries, salary schedules of local universities will be reviewed. Historical trends in benefits will also be reviewed and considered as part of the justification for salary increase.
    Curriculum Alignment
- Jonathan Lee, History - Chair
- Dawn Elmore-McCrary, English
- Jane Focht-Hansen, English
- Ellen Marshall, Early Childhood Studies
- Susan Paddock, Mathematics & Computer Science
- Committee Charge:
To collect and provide information to the Faculty Senate and the faculty at large through use of the Faculty Senate Homepage on programs and policies relating to:
- P-16 Curriculum Alignment initiatives at the state and local level including the development and implementation of college ready standards.
- ACCD pursuit of common catalogues, course descriptions, and other curriculum matters.
- SAC pedagogical training and initiatives.
- SAC outreach programs with P-12 community.

    Policy and Governance
- Terry Walch, Counseling & Student Development - Chair
- Thomas Clarkin, History
- Dawn Elmore-McCrary, English
- Mekonnen Haile, English
- Jerry Purcell, Biological Sciences
- Jan Starnes, Counseling & Student Development
- Christy Woodward-Kaupert, Political Science
- Sylvia Ybarra, Reading & Education
- Committee Charge:
1) To monitor implementation of existing College and District policies.
2) To act as liaison between Senate and any other District or College committee that deals with policy issues.
3) To bring to the Senate recommendations for new policies or alterations of existing policies that affect the educational mission of the College.
